Web10 Jun 2024 · Swan Lake is based on a folktale about the princess Odette, who has been transformed into a swan by the evil sorcerer Baron von Rothbart. Von Rothbart’s curse can only be broken if Odette finds true love. All hopes are pinned on Prince Siegfried, whose mother has organised a lavish ball to find him a suitable princess to marry. WebThree swan species can be found in Wisconsin -- trumpeter, tundra and the non-native mute swan. Trumpeter and tundra swans are migratory species whereas mute swans are an introduced non-native species that tend to remain year-round. All have white plumage as adults and appear similar from a distance. Aderyn must fly to unchartered territories and risk the lives of everyone she loves to defeat her enemies, … robins and thrushesWebA group of swans in the water might be called a bevy, flock or bank of swans. The term bank of swans refers to how swans flock on the sides - or banks - of rivers and lakes.
